Summary: | flop Now that was a flour barrell chair,you know,sawed off.They had a flop here in 'em,see,used to rise up,cover. Rise up the cover an' that's where they put all their sewin' and knittin' and' everything down in that,see. (ie flap; piece of wood which could be raised to give access to interior of barrell used as chair) Yes DNE-cit J.D.A. WIDDOWSON JAN 1974 Not used Not used Withdrawn |
